Pairing wine with food enhances the dining experience, and Merlot is a versatile red wine that complements many dishes. When paired with grilled vegetables and garlic aioli, Merlot can bring out the flavors of the meal while providing a smooth, balanced taste.
Why Choose Merlot?
Merlot is known for its soft tannins, fruity flavors, and medium body. Its notes of plum, cherry, and raspberry make it an excellent match for the smoky, savory flavors of grilled vegetables. The wine’s smoothness balances the richness of garlic aioli, creating a harmonious pairing.
Perfect Vegetables for Grilling
- Zucchini
- Bell peppers
- Eggplant
- Asparagus
- Mushrooms
These vegetables develop a delicious smoky flavor when grilled, which pairs beautifully with the fruitiness of Merlot. Marinate or brush them with olive oil and herbs before grilling for added flavor.
Making Garlic Aioli
Garlic aioli is a creamy, flavorful sauce that complements grilled vegetables perfectly. Here’s a simple recipe:
- 1 cup mayonnaise
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 tablespoon lemon juice
- Salt and pepper to taste
Mix all ingredients until smooth. Adjust the garlic and lemon to taste. Chill before serving for the best flavor.
Serving Suggestions
Grill the vegetables until tender and slightly charred. Serve them drizzled with garlic aioli and a glass of chilled Merlot. This pairing works well for casual gatherings or a sophisticated dinner.
Remember, the key is balance. The fruitiness of Merlot enhances the smoky, savory flavors of the vegetables, while the garlic aioli adds richness and depth. Enjoy your meal and the perfect wine pairing!
